The correlation between historical prices or returns on Consumer Services and Summit Global is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Summit Global Investments are associated (or correlated) with Consumer Services.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of Consumer Services has no effect on the direction of Summit Global i.e., Summit Global and Consumer Services go up and down completely randomly.

The main advantage of trading using opposite Summit Global and Consumer Services posit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Summit Global position performs unexpectedly, Consumer Services can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
